原文:HBase介紹

HBase介紹 HBase是Hadoop生態系統中一個重要的NOSQL存儲,它一些設計思想來自於Google的Bigtable,因此在Key Value存儲結構上與同出一門的Cassandra有相似之處。 一,HBase出現的背景 隨着數據規模越來越大,大量業務場景開始考慮數據存儲水平擴展,使得存儲服務可以增加 刪除,而目前的關系型數據庫更專注於一台機器。 海量數據量存儲成為瓶頸,單台機器無法負 ...

2012-03-22 17:40 1 2932 推薦指數:

查看詳情

HBase 1、HBase介紹和工作原理

  HBase是一個分布式的、面向列的開源數據庫,該技術來源於 Fay Chang 所撰寫的Google論文“Bigtable:一個結構化數據的分布式存儲系統”。就像Bigtable利用了Google文件系統(File System)所提供的分布式數據存儲一樣,HBase在Hadoop之上提供 ...

Tue Mar 01 06:25:00 CST 2016 1 38290
Hbase記錄-ZooKeeper介紹

ZooKeeper是一個分布式協調服務來管理大量的主機。協調和管理在分布式環境的一個服務是一個復雜的過程。ZooKeeper 簡單解決了其結構和API這個問題。ZooKeeper允許開發人員能夠專注於 ...

Tue Oct 24 00:53:00 CST 2017 0 1315
HBase Snapshot功能介紹

HBase在0.94之后提供了Snapshot功能,一個snapshot其實就是一組metadata信息的集合,它可以讓管理員將表恢復到以前的一個狀態。snapshot並不是一份拷貝,它只是一個文件名的列表,並不拷貝數據。一個全的snapshot恢復以為着你可以回滾到原來的表schema ...

Sun May 10 22:17:00 CST 2015 0 6346
HBase(基於HDFS)的介紹及安裝

一:HBase簡介 (一)HBase了解(實現對大<普通PC集群、十億行,百萬列>數據隨機、實時存取操作) 前提: HBase是一個高可靠、高性能、面向列、可伸縮的分布式數據庫,是建立在hdfs之上,被設計用來提供高可靠性,高性能、列存儲、可伸縮、多版本 ...

Tue Mar 03 22:46:00 CST 2020 0 837
HBase的TTL介紹

1. 定義 TTL(Time to Live) 用於限定數據的超時時間。 2.原理 以Column Family的TTL為例介紹, CF默認的TTL值是FOREVER,也就是永不過期。 修改TTL的值,CF的TTL的值以秒為單位 ...

Thu Sep 21 22:39:00 CST 2017 1 10809
HBase介紹及簡易安裝

HBase簡介 HBase是Apache Hadoop的數據庫,能夠對大型數據提供隨機、實時的讀寫訪問,是Google的BigTable的開源實現。HBase的目標是存儲並處理大型的數據,更具體地說僅用普通的硬件配置,能夠處理成千上萬的行和列所組成的大型數據庫。HBase是一個開源的、分布式 ...

Fri Jul 25 16:31:00 CST 2014 0 71526
HBase MVCC 機制介紹

關鍵詞:MVCC HBase 一致性 本文最好結合源碼進行閱讀 什么是MVCC ? MVCC(MultiVersionConsistencyControl , 多版本控制協議),是一種通過數據的多版本來解決讀寫一致性問題的解決方案。在隔離性級別中,MVCC可以解決“可重復 ...

Tue Nov 14 07:16:00 CST 2017 0 1321
HBase在HDFS上的目錄介紹

總所周知,HBase 是天生就是架設在 HDFS 上,在這個分布式文件系統中,HBase 是怎么去構建自己的目錄樹的呢? 第一,介紹系統級別的目錄樹。 一、0.94-cdh4.2.1版本 系統級別的一級目錄如下,用戶自定義的均在這個/hbase 下的一級子目錄下 /hbase/-ROOT- ...

Sun Jun 10 01:24:00 CST 2018 0 2192
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M